Arranged for clarinet quintet, this is the adagio, by Zipoli, made famous by so much airtime on Classic FM. The music was originally intended to be played on the organ during the “Elevation of the Host” section of the Catholic Mass – hence the title.
It sounds particularly beautiful on this kind of? ensemble. The melody is in the 1st Bb clarinet and the other parts form a chordal accompaniment.
